Output 89c597950cccea18ae673c6fc75d462b0b6b854c91af9dcb17da83f2a67c1bb0:24

value
20242
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 48dde3d396b2296c58aac9e6199e855ee482c595a60718ce753eb4cb700edf5a
address
bc1pfrw785ukkg5kck92e8npn859tmjg93v45cr33nn4866vkuqwmadqz3u06k
transaction
89c597950cccea18ae673c6fc75d462b0b6b854c91af9dcb17da83f2a67c1bb0
spent
true